1. Proactive Exclusion: Your First Line of Defense

The best way to deal with infestations is to stop them before they start. Proactive exclusion is the gold standard for preventing common pests Melbourne.

  • Seal Gaps and Cracks: Melbourne’s shifting clay soils often cause small cracks in foundations and brickwork. Inspect your property regularly for gaps in walls, doors, and windows. Sealing these is the first line of defense against rodents and spiders looking for a winter retreat.

  • Keep Outdoor Areas Clean: Remove debris like damp leaf litter and fallen branches. In the humid Melbourne suburbs, these act as primary breeding grounds for cockroaches and ants.

  • Manage Moisture: Fix leaking taps immediately. A single dripping pipe in a laundry or sub-floor provides enough water to sustain an entire cockroach colony or attract subterranean termites.

2. Professional Exclusion vs. DIY

While DIY steps are a great start, Melbourne’s unique architecture—from Victorian terraces in Richmond to new builds in the West—requires specialized knowledge. Professional exclusion involves installing “weep hole” protectors and door seals that allow necessary ventilation while blocking pest entry.

3. Food Hygiene and Waste Management

Food is the ultimate attractant. Whether you are managing a commercial kitchen in the CBD or a residential pantry, cleanliness is non-negotiable for preventing common pests Melbourne.

  • Proper Waste Disposal: Always store garbage in tightly sealed bins. In Melbourne’s summer, unsealed bins become magnets for flies and rodents.

  • Airtight Storage: Keep pantry staples in glass or heavy-duty plastic containers. Pests like silverfish and pantry moths can easily chew through cardboard packaging.

4. Property Maintenance Hotspots

Routine cleaning often misses the areas where pests thrive. To stay ahead of the game:

  • Under Appliances: Vacuum under refrigerators and stoves where crumbs accumulate.

  • Roof and Attic: Ensure there are no leaks or nests in the roof void that could attract rodents or birds.

  • Dehumidify: Use dehumidifiers in damp basements or sub-floors to deter moisture-loving pests like termites.

5. Pest Identification: Knowing Your Enemy

Identifying the pest is crucial for choosing the right treatment. Here is what to look for in Melbourne:

  • Ants: Often seen in kitchens during dry spells searching for moisture.

  • Rodents: Look for droppings or gnaw marks in cupboards.

  • Cockroaches: They thrive in warm, dark environments like behind dishwashers.
